Calibrate has a scientific connotation as it refers to adjusting or measuring the accuracy of a device or instrument.
The word "Regurgitate" has a scientific connotation as it is often used in the context of digestion and biology to describe the process of expelling food from the stomach.
The word with a scientific connotation is crawling. It refers to the movement of an organism using its limbs or body close to the ground, typically in a slow and creeping manner. This term is commonly used in biology or zoology to describe the locomotion of animals.
